0NL-TW2 by Oyang is a
dual-station paper rope twisting machine designed for high-speed production of twisted paper ropes used in paper handle making and bag manufacturing. It uses rolls of kraft paper as raw material and twists them into ropes on two parallel stations for increased throughput.

| Feature | Specification |
| Model | 0NL-TW2 Double Station Twisted Paper Rope Machine |
| Brand | Oyang |
| Core Diameter of Raw Rope Roll | 76 mm (3) |
| Max. Paper Rope Diameter (web) | Up to 800 mm |
| Paper Roll Width | 20 100 mm |
| Paper Thickness (GSM) | 20 60 g/m |
| Finished Paper Rope Diameter | 2.5 6 mm |
| Max. Finished Rope Roll Diameter | 300 mm |
| Max. Paper Rope Width | 300 mm |
| Production Speed | 30 40 m/min |
| Power Supply | 220 V |
| Total Motor Power | ~1.5 kW |
| Total Weight | ~300 kg |
| Overall Dimensions (LWH) | ~1580 1440 930 mm |
Efficient Production for Paper Bag HandlesThis machine is optimized for the quick and uniform production of twisted paper ropes, which are essential for paper bag handles. The dual-station feature doubles productivity without compromising rope quality. Its adjustable settings support various rope diameters and twist pitches, and the user-friendly PLC control ensures smooth operation with minimal supervision.
Versatile Application with Quality ControlDesigned to process kraft and virgin paper, the machine accommodates paper rolls up to 1000 mm in diameter and widths from 20 to 100 mm. Advanced technologies such as photoelectric correction and automatic film length counting guarantee consistent, high-quality rope suitable for diverse paper bag handle requirements.
FAQ's of Double Station Twisted Paper Rope Machine:
Q: How does the Double Station Twisted Paper Rope Machine operate?
A: The machine uses electric drive and PLC-based controls with a touchscreen interface, making operation straightforward. Paper is fed into the machine, twisted to the selected pitch and diameter, and automatically wound onto reels at both stations for maximized production.
Q: What types of paper can be used with this machine?
A: The machine is compatible with kraft paper and virgin paper. It supports a wide range of paper widths (20-100 mm) and can handle rolls with a maximum diameter of up to 1000 mm, ensuring versatility for various handle rope specifications.

Q: What are the benefits of using a double station configuration?
A: A double station design allows for simultaneous production on two outlets, effectively doubling output rates compared to single-station machines. This increases efficiency, reduces downtime, and enhances overall productivity for businesses.
Q: How is uniform twisting and rope quality ensured?
A: The machine is equipped with features like photoelectric correction, automatic film length counter, and PLC-controlled adjustments. These technologies ensure uniform twisting, precise dimensions, and high-quality output on a consistent basis.
